Tamoxifen

/(tă*mŏk"sĭ*fĕn)/ · Ta·mox·i·fen · IPA /təˈmɑk.sɪf.ən/

    a chemical compound (C26H29NO) which is non-steroidal but physiogically active as an estrogen antagonist. It is used to treat postmenopausal breast cancer. Chemically it is 1-p-dimethylaminoethoxyphenyl-trans-1,2-diphenyl-but-1-ene. It can be obtained as a white crystalline powder.
